Transaction 573005ad502b3a248d71c811368620a72c9f32863f557f2e38efa20cd776cb39

block
04d613694b6c4a6fafe9e77fbdb1d5a3d231d6c39f5f06e1dbc837c07fc68e08

1 Input

7 Outputs